Kozhikode railway station is set to open a coach-themed restaurant as part of Southern Railway's 'Food on Wheels' initiative, featuring decommissioned train carriages converted into dining spaces with additional facilities. Similar projects are underway at other stations.
- Kozhikode railway station to launch coach-themed restaurant as part of Southern Railway's 'Food on Wheels' initiative
- Project involves converting decommissioned train carriages into air-conditioned dining spaces with additional facilities like kitchen, bakery, and retail stalls
- Similar restaurants are being developed at Payyannur, Palakkad Town, and Mattanchery Halt stations
